Australian Shorts 2011

Winner of Best Australian Short Documentary, 2011:

OL’ BLUE EYES

Directed by Matt Cooney | Australia | 2009 | 8 min

The life of Sydney taxi driver, Zachary Kryuchkov, who is a classically trained singer from Ukraine who plays his customers his CDs.

 

All Gone, Extreme Clean

Martin Jehle | Australia | 2010 | 19 min

A film about a woman who set up a crime scene clean up company after her friend committed suicide.

 

Brisbane Blacks

Ben Carr | Australia | 2010 | 11 min

The story of the Indigenous band Mop and the Dropouts that used music to raise political issues, most noticeably the protests that surrounded the Commonwealth games in 1982.

 

Comme Ci Comme Ça: The Story of Carmen Rupe

Lucy Hayes | Australia | 2010 | 11 min

A fascinating documentary that introduces us to 74 year old Carmen; one of Sydney’s original drag queens and showgirls.

 

Fists of Affection

Dave Mitchell | Australia | 2009 | 3 min

A story about a priest who began a campaign to stop a Muslim cleric being deported from Australia.

 

Night Fare

William Head | Australia | 2009 | 5 min

A voyeuristic look at a Melbourne taxi driver, taking a break to enjoy a meal.

 

On Violence

Ricardo Skaff | Australia | 2010 | 7 min

One man’s reflections on violence.

 

The Rise of Leatherman

Kim Munro | Australia | 2008 | 10 min

A very personal yet lighthearted film about an individual’s desire to be crowned “Leatherman of the Year”.

 

Sink or Swim

Amelia Kelly | Australia | 2010

The story of an Afghani immigrant who began swimming classes for immigrants in Parramatta after her son drowned.

 

Skin

Tom Noakes | Australia | 2009

A film that follows Sydney’s body modification martyr Joeltron, exploring the reasons and struggles behind his unique form of self-expression.

 

This is How You’ll Make Your Bed in Prison

Katie Mitchell | Australia | 2009 | 10 min

A retrospectively told story of an Indigenous woman who took on the government over plans to take away the right to vote from people in prison.

 

Three. Art

Martin Ingle | Australia | 2010 | 12 min

A film exploring what art means through interviews with three artists: a writer, a musician and a photographer.
